The title compound 2-amino-5,6-dihydro-4-(3,4-dimethoxyphenyl)-4H-benzo[h]- chromene-3-carbonitrile (C22H20N2O3, Mr = 360.40) was obtained by the reaction of 2-(3,4-dimeth- oxybenzylidene)-1-tetralone and malononitrile in DMF in the presence of KF-montmorillonite. Its structure was confirmed by IR and ^1H NMR spectra. The crystal is of monoclinic, space group C2/c with a = 24.101(6), b = 9.146(2), c = 17.238(3) ,A, β= 95.92(2)°, Z = 8, V= 3779.4(14) ,A^3, Dc = 1.267 g/cm^3, μ(MoKa) = 0.085 mm^-1, F(000) = 1520, R = 0.0409 and wR = 0.0981 for 2043 observed reflections (I 〉 2σ(I)). 展开更多

The title compound (C28H19Cl2N) has been synthesized by the reaction of dibenzoylmethane and N-(4-chlorobenzylidene)-4-chlorobenzenamine promoted by low-valent titanium reagent, and characterized by elemental analysis, IR, ^1H NMR and X-ray single-crystal diffraction. The crystal belongs to monoclinic, space group P2 1/C with a = 9.952(2), b = 9.863(2), c = 23.460(6) A, β = 99.62(2)°, V = 2270.4(9) A^3, Mr = 440.34, Z = 4, Dc = 1.288 g/cm^3, μ(MoKa) = 0.301 mm^-1, F(000) = 912, the final R = 0.0387 and wR = 0.0793. X-ray analysis reveals that the four phenyl rings in the pyrrole ring are not coplanar. 展开更多
